Vice-President: Anderson – Wilson Correspondence, 1958-1969, undated
Scope and Contents
Maurice J. Anderson was the then Vice-President of HKBC. During his absence, George Wilson was Acting Vice-President and Dean of Studies from 1958-1965. This folder mainly contains letters written by George to Anderson ,from 1958 to 1959 and from 1964 to 1965, concerning the College’s policies, programs and other matters such as staff recruitment and fund-raising activities during the aforesaid period. It also contains his correspondence with others such as Lam Chi-fung and David Wong.
